The 1979 Pontiac Firebird Trans Am WS6 is a standout muscle car of its time, boasting a V8 engine and impressive design that made it an instant classic. The WS6 package further enhanced its performance and handling, making it a highly sought-after option for enthusiasts and collectors alike.

Under the hood, the Trans Am WS6 packs a punch with its 6.6-liter V8 engine, capable of producing up to 220 horsepower and 320 lb-ft of torque. It features a four-barrel carburetor, and a high-performance camshaft, making it a beast on the road.

The WS6 package also includes improved handling and suspension, with stiffer springs, larger sway bars, and a tighter steering ratio, all working together to create a more responsive and agile ride. It also includes four-wheel disc brakes, which provide excellent stopping power and greater control during cornering.

In terms of design, the Firebird Trans Am WS6 1979 is a classic muscle car, with its iconic twin scooped hood, bold signature graphics, and air intake on the hood. It also features a rear deck spoiler, flared fenders, and unique front and rear fascias, giving it an aggressive and sporty appearance.

Inside, the WS6 package adds a set of comfortable bucket seats, trimmed in velour fabric. Additional features include a tilt steering column, power windows, and air conditioning, all designed to provide a comfortable and enjoyable driving experience.

Overall, the 1979 Pontiac Firebird Trans Am WS6 is a true classic muscle car, combining exceptional performance, handling, and design. It is a highly coveted car for collectors and enthusiasts, and its value is likely to continue to appreciate over time

Milestones

- The Body: The body was completely restyled for 1979, featuring a new aerodynamic front end, revised rear end spoiler - The Engine: For 1979, there were three possible engine options: The L80 Oldsmobile 403 6.6L V8, the W72 Pontiac 400 6.6L V8 for a short time and in a limited supply, and L37 Pontiac 301 4.9L V8 -Limited edition: A limited edition Firebird was produced for the 1979 model year, to commemorate the 10th anniversary of the 1969 Firebird Trans Am - Recognition: Car and Driver magazine named Trans Am equipped with the WSP Special Performance Package the best handling car of 1979 - End of production: The 1981 model year became the final run for the second generation Pontiac Firebird


Technical

- Engine: 6.6-liter V8 - Horsepower: 220 hp - Torque: 320 lb-ft - Transmission: 4-speed manual or 3-speed automatic - Rear axle ratio: 3.23:1 - Suspension: WS6 handling package - Brakes: 4-wheel disc brakes - Wheels: 15x8-inch snowflake wheels - Tires: 225/70R15 or 245/60R15 - Exterior colors: Black, white, silver, red, gold, and blue - Interior colors: Black, white, and camel - Hood: Shaker hood scoop - Spoiler: Rear wing spoiler - Seats: Bucket seats with cloth upholstery or optional leather - Gauges: Rally gauges including tachometer, oil pressure, temperature, and fuel - Sound system: AM/FM radio with 8-track player or optional cassette player - Air conditioning: Optional - Power windows and locks: Optional - Steering: Power steering - Exhaust: Dual exhaust system with chrome tips.
